Penske offers tracking service

Penske Truck Leasing Co., L.P. customers are now able to track trucks via the web using the company's Fleet InSite truck tracking system, which combines GPS and cellular wireless communications.

The system enables fleet managers to “ping” a vehicle and access its location history including the date, time, speed, longitude/latitude, travel direction and street address.

“The technology allows customers to be only a point and click away from information such as how close a driver is to delivering product or where a vehicle is stopped,” said Jim Feenstra, senior vp of marketing.

Fleet InSite is immediately available to Penske's full-service lease customers throughout North America, with availability for contract maintenance customers coming “shortly.” The pricing starts at $10 per month, including hardware and installation, and charges may be included as part of the vehicle lease.
